PLDC - The managing director of Naft Abadan club told reporters that after the unsuccessful attempt to change the ruling of Iran Football Federation and Iran's athletic association, the team has taken its complaint to FIFA. It was reported that legally IFF's ruling can not be changed by the other organization and therefore Naft Football club has no choice but to take the matter to FIFA. Regarding the comments the head coach of the team had made earlier about the team's future, the managing director said that Mr Mazlomi as the head coach cannot comment on such issues and this is something that the management has to decide on, which at this point is taken to FIFA for review. |
